Response to Controller Mapping for Flash Games! 2025-05-17 07:13:21


At 5/17/25 06:01 AM, Guidodinho wrote:And super funny thing about the mouse support here. Android seems to natively use that trackpad on the PS5 controller as a mouse cursor. And I can fully navigate my phone with it, like I would with my finger. But I can click on anything I want with it, EXCEPT for anything going on, inside the Ruffle screen, for some bizare reason.
What also would be a cool work-around for that, is if there would be an extra button mapped, that just functions at that mouse-click, where the cursor is currently at.


I'm not sure what our capabilities are regarding mapping controllers to mouse clicks but will see.


(I also had to set the browser on my phone to desktop-mode, btw, to bypass the device incompatibility error message, but that was no problem for me)


Josh has made an update to bypass the blocker, it might be launching today!


(And going full -screen kinda gets me that semi-unused space at the edges of the screen, might wanna get a kinda black border layed over that area for when you right-click to hit full-screen, or some neat border art! ';D)


We were tinkering with our Ruffle parameters to add black bars but it doesn't appear to be a working feature in Ruffle at the moment, hoping with a future update we will be able to do that.
